iPad as an Interactive White Board for $5 or $10
This setup is actually better than an Interactive White Board in several ways. Not only is it vastly cheaper, but it also permits a teacher or student to be anywhere in the room when writing on the iPad/projected computer image

How Students View a Moodle page (Research on Eye tracking across a Course)
This work describes an eye tracking study of Moodle outlining how Moodle’s components and teaching materials are ‘seen’ by Moodle users.
Engrade: a Free, Online Grade Book
Engrade is a free online gradebook that is easy to use, fully functional, and allows students and parents to view their grades.
